Clear aligners are removable trays planned as a sequence. They can be discreet and convenient, but they still depend on diagnosis, biomechanics and consistent wear.

A useful starting point is to define the orthodontic problem that needs to be corrected and then compare the options that can predictably achieve that goal. Appearance and convenience matter, but neither should replace diagnosis.

An orthodontic assessment can include the health and position of the teeth, the way the upper and lower teeth meet, available space, gum and bone support, facial and jaw relationships, growth when relevant, and the patient’s ability to follow treatment instructions. Records may include photographs, digital scans and radiographs when clinically indicated.

Planning treatment

Braces treatment is a sequence, not a single appointment.

Active orthodontic treatment typically moves through diagnosis and records, appliance placement or delivery, repeated monitoring and adjustments, finishing of the bite, appliance removal and retention. The details vary from patient to patient.

Good treatment planning also anticipates practical issues: hygiene, broken appliances, sports, travel, missed appointments, elastic wear and what happens if the teeth do not respond exactly as expected.

Questions patients ask

Common questions

Are clear aligners the same as braces?
No. Both can move teeth, but they use different appliances and have different strengths, limitations and compliance requirements.
Can every braces case be treated with Invisalign?
No. Suitability depends on the diagnosis, movements required and the clinician’s plan.
Do aligners need to be worn most of the day?
Yes. Removable aligners generally require consistent daily wear as directed by the treating clinician.
